In a post on X Tuesday morning, Google DeepMind CEO Demis Hassabis called for the creation of a new regulatory body to oversee the release of the Frontier model. The post, titled “Frontier AI Frameworks and the Dawn of a New Era,” makes the case for a “standards body” modeled after the Financial Industry Regulatory Authority (FINRA) that can test frontier models and develop best practices for their release.
“Initially, Frontier Labs voluntarily shared models with standards bodies for review up to 30 days before release,” the post reads. “Formalization could occur soon if the evaluation protocol is shown to be effective and robust, meaning the Frontier model would need to pass it before it can be deployed to the U.S. market. The Institute also plans to work with standards bodies to address critical vulnerabilities post-release.”
The proposed system builds on an ad hoc review conducted by the U.S. government of Anthropic’s Mythos and OpenAI’s Sol. These reviews generated significant criticism for a lack of technical expertise and opaque decision-making regarding when models were released. Under Hassabis’ proposed regulator, those decisions could be handed over to a new organization that would be run independently and funded by the AI industry, with support from the U.S. government.
The outlook for AI regulation remains controversial for both the tech industry and the Trump administration. Most recently, White House AI advisor and a16z general partner Sriram Krishnan dismissed the possibility of an AI regulator within the executive branch, saying, “There is no FDA for AI.”
Establishing standards bodies as self-regulatory bodies like FINRA could be a way to address these concerns. Hassabis envisions the necessary financial support from the AI lab to staff and retain industry open source representatives and technical experts at the regulator. Some assessments could also be outsourced to a growing number of AI safety groups that can specialize in specific risks.
“The strength of this approach is that it can be technologically focused while simultaneously supporting innovation and encouraging responsible behavior,” Hassabis argues. “It is designed to follow the acceleration on the ground and adapt to the greatest risks as they are identified, and can be escalated in stages as the severity of the situation requires.”
